Two men have been taken to hospital following a disturbance in Salvesen Crescent this morning.

Its believed both males, aged around eighteen, suffered stab wounds during the incident.

A Police Scotland spokeswoman said: “Police in Edinburgh are investigating after two males sustained serious injuries in a disturbance in the Salvesen Crescent area around 7am.

“The males were taken to the Edinburgh Royal Infirmary for treatment for their injuries which are not thought to be life-threatening.

“Inquiries into the full circumstances are at an early stage and ongoing.

“Anyone with information is asked to contact officers at Corstorphine CID on 101.
